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Inclusion criteria:
  • Married adult woman (all married women are considered adults in Afghanistan, regardless of age)
  • Has a child between 6 and 23 months of age. For women with more than one living child between ages 6 and 23 months, questions will be asked regarding dietary experiences for the elder of the two. For twins or multiple order siblings, the eldest will be selected based on birth order.
  • Resident in the household
  • Exclusion criteria:
  • No specific exclusion criteria.
